Output 727cc3232146c6e05751d7674ff35e7b5f621c302963ee20e5526df8131ca95e:0

value
63500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74c6ca81bcd24da8e0bb023d723146e28b39e4d OP_EQUAL
address
3MKQkrHHiXbiH6Vj6yxoSeBWHYKVfQs4jY
transaction
727cc3232146c6e05751d7674ff35e7b5f621c302963ee20e5526df8131ca95e
spent
true